School Overview

Chisholm Life Skills Center is a public school located in Wichita, Kansas. It is a school in Wichita Unified School District 259 district.

It has 99 students through grade 10 to 12. The students to teacher ratio is 11 to 1 where a total of 9 teachers are teaching for the school.

Student Population

A total of 99 students are attending Chisholm Life Skills Center. By gender, there are 56 and 43 female students at the school.

Teachers & Staffs

Total 9 full-time (or equivalent) teachers work for Chisholm Life Skills Center and the students to teacher ratio is 11 to 1. 77.8% of teachers are certified. All teachers have 3 or more years teaching experiences.
